The National Weather Service in Memphis has issued a * Severe Thunderstorm Warning for... East central Chickasaw County in northeastern Mississippi... Southwestern Itawamba County in northeastern Mississippi... Southeastern Lee County in northeastern Mississippi... Monroe County in northeastern Mississippi... * Until 945 PM CDT. * At 911 PM CDT, a severe thunderstorm was located over New Wren, or near Amory, moving southeast at 45 mph. HAZARD...60 mph wind gusts and nickel size hail. SOURCE...Radar indicated. IMPACT...Expect damage to roofs, siding, and trees. * Locations impacted include... Amory, Aberdeen, Okolona, Smithville, Prairie, New Wren, Nettleton, Hatley, Gattman, Binford, Sipsey Fork, New Hamilton, Becker, Quincy, Turon, Egypt, Splunge, Wise Gap, Athens and Wren. HAIL THREAT...RADAR INDICATED MAX HAIL SIZE...0.88 IN WIND THREAT...RADAR INDICATED MAX WIND GUST...60 MPH
